#833. 希蒙打比赛
希蒙打比赛
题目描述
希蒙正在组织同学们进行比赛,比赛最后的排名首先会按照总分从大到小进行排名,如果总分相同的,会按照所有题的总提交时间,总提交时间越早的排名越高,如果提交时间也相同,那么按照编号顺序小的在前。但是作为一个严格的比赛,希蒙会随时检查考场纪律,如果发现有谁出现了任何违规舞弊的情况,那么会直接在这名同学的总分减少一半,如果出现小数,向下取整。
输入格式
共n+1行。
第行为一个正整数,表示参加比赛的人数。
第2行,有个用空格隔开的数字,表示每名同学的分数
第3行,有个用空格隔开的数字,表示每名同学提交题目的耗时
第4行,有个用空格隔开的数字,由0或者1组成,1表示每名同学存在作弊的情况。
每个学生的学号按照输入顺序编号为。
输出格式
共n行,按照排名依次输出学生的编号
样例 #1
样例输入 #1
5
600 400 400 400 123
100 2300 1111 1111 6000
1 0 0 0 0
样例输出 #1
3
4
2
1
5